High school volleyball season has gotten into the full swing with a full slate of matches for Kanzaland area schools last night. Check out the August 28th scoreboard below:
Twin Valley League:
Onaga Triangular:
Onaga def. Blue Valley-Randolph 25-11, 25-22
Onaga def. Wetmore 19-25, 25-22, 25-13
Wetmore def. Blue Valley-Randolph 25-18, 25-20
Linn Triangular:
Centralia def. Linn 25-15, 25-20
Centralia def. Clifton-Clyde 24-26, 25-14, 25-7
Linn def. Clifton-Clyde 25-10, 25-18
Axtell Triangular:
Washington County def. Axtell 25-13, 25-20
Washington County def. B&B 25-22, 25-18
B&B def. Axtell 25-9, 25-16
Hanover Triangular:
Valley Heights def. Frankfort 27-25, 25-14
Valley Heights def. Hanover 25-22, 25-20
Hanover def. Frankfort 27-25, 25-14
Delaware Valley League:
Jefferson County North Triangular:
JCN def. Immaculata 26-24, 25-21
JCN def. Pleasant Ridge 25-20, 25-17
Immaculata def. Pleasant Ridge 25-18, 25-20
Riverside Triangular:
Riverside def. Troy 25-23, 25-10
Riverside def. Jackson Heights 25-13, 25-13
Troy def. Jackson Heights 25-17, 25-22
Valley Falls Triangular
Valley Falls def. McLouth 25-9, 25-20
Valley Falls def. Oskaloosa 25-5, 25-12
Oskaloosa def. McLouth 25-16, 21-25, 25-23
ACCHS Triangular
ACCHS def. Doniphan West 25-7, 23-25, 25-21
Maur Hill-Mount Academy def. Doniphan West 25-21, 25-23
Maur Hill-Mount Academy def. ACCHS 25-21, 17-25, 25-23
Big Seven League:
Jeff West won both matches over Hiawatha---1st match (25-15, 25-19); 2nd match (25-16, 25-16)
Holton went 1-1 at Wabaunsee (Holton beat Wabaunsee in 3 sets ---24-26, 25-21, 25-15
lost to Riley County in 2 sets---25-21, 25-23)
Nemaha Valley and Perry Lecompton split a pair of matches
(Nemaha Valley def. Perry Lecompton 25-24, 25-15)
(Perry Lecompton def. Nemaha Valley 21-25, 25-21, 25-20)
